如何用if语句判断是否为空值?

如题所述

IF(ISERROR(X),"",X)是一个防止报错的经典公式。
(1)函数分析
①ISERROR(X1)的意思是:判断括号内的公式是否出错,如果出错则返回“TRUE”,若没有出错则返回“FALSE”。
②IF函数用来判断ISERROR函数返回的值,如果返回值为“TRUE”即公式出错,那么此时将输出“”,也即输出空值,单元格表现为空白;如果返回值为“FALSE”即公式正确,那么将返回这个公式的计算结果。
(2)举例
比较常见的用法是对于VLOOKUP函数的判断,如IF(ISERROR(VLOOKUP(A1,A1:A10,1,0)),"",VLOOKUP(VLOOKUP(A1,A1:A10,1,0)),该公式的计算步骤为:
①先计算“VLOOKUP(A1,A1:A10,1,0)”,如果这个公式成立,那么ISERROR返回“FALSE”,那么IF函数返回"FALSE"情况下的值,即“VLOOKUP(A1,A1:A10,1,0)”,VLOOKUP函数需要查找返回的值;
②如果“VLOOKUP(A1,A1:A10,1,0)”这个公式不成立,比如常见的情况是在指定查找区域无要查找的值,则此时ISERROR函数返回“TRUE”,那么IF函数返回"TRUE"情况下的值,即“”,此时单元格显示了空值。
③如果不用IF和ISERROR嵌套,直接用VLOOKUP函数嵌套,那么当VLOOKUP不成立时,单元格就会出现“#N/A”报错提示,影响文档效果。
温馨提示:内容为网友见解,仅供参考
无其他回答

if函数怎样判断是否为空值?
1、打开需要操作的excel表格。2、选中单元格c2,依次点击【插入】、【插入函数】。3、在弹出的窗口选中【IF】,点击【确定】。4、在一个参数框输入【a2""】,即不为空。5、在第二个参数框输入【a2&b2】,即将a2和b2中的内容连接起来。6、在第三个参数框输入【b3】,点击【确定】。7...

如何在excel中用if语句判断是否为空值
1、打开需要操作的EXCEL表格,在目标单元格中输入公式=IF(AND(A1="",B1=""),"","88")并回车即可。2、可发现A1、B1均为空值,目标单元格显示空值。3、任意在A1或者B1中输入任意文本,可发现目标单元格C1已显示出需要显示的内容“88”。

怎么判断一个单元格是否是空值呢?
1、打开需要进行操作的文档,此处以判断以下四个单元格是否含有字符“4”为例。2、在B1单元格中输入公式=IF(ISNUMBER(FIND("4",A1)),"有","无"),此处第一个引号内表示要判断的字符,即4,第二个引号表示要判断的单元格,即A1。3、敲下回车键,B1单元格内出现判断结果。4、选中B1单元格,...

如何用if函数判断是否为空值?
直拉用=0就行了,回为空值也等于0。非要两个条件都写上,可用or excel的if函数是这样用的:EXCEL中的IF函数是一个判断函数,也可以说是一个分支函数,可以根据条件判断的不同结果而返回不同的值,它的基本语法是:IF(A,B,C),解释为如果A是真则该函数返回结果B,否则返回结果C。举例:1、...

如何用if语句判断是否为空值?
IF(ISERROR(X),"",X)是一个防止报错的经典公式。(1)函数分析 ①ISERROR(X1)的意思是:判断括号内的公式是否出错,如果出错则返回“TRUE”,若没有出错则返回“FALSE”。②IF函数用来判断ISERROR函数返回的值,如果返回值为“TRUE”即公式出错,那么此时将输出“”,也即输出空值,单元格表现为空白...

关于excel IF判断“空值”的公式
Excel判断单元格空值可以使用内置函数"ISBLANK"。以题中所举例子为例, B1单元格可填入如下命令, 达到题中所叙效果:=IF(ISBLANK(A1),0,1)上述公式意为判断A1单元格内是否为空, 若结果为真, B1单元格输出为0, 反之, B1单元格输出为1。

excel怎么用公式判断是否是空值?
1、打开excel文件,如图所示:2、选择“公式”功能,如图所示:3、选择“逻辑”功能,如图所示:4、选择“IF”函数,如下图所示,如图所示:5、在函数对话框中,输入如下所示的公式内容,代表了如果结果大于0就显示结果,如果结果小于0就显示0,如图所示:6、点击“确定”后结果如下,如图所示:7、第...

关于excel IF判断“空值”的公式
=IF(ISBLANK(A1), 0, 1)这个公式的作用是检查A1单元格的内容,如果为空,B1将显示0;反之,如果A1有值,B1则显示1。ISBLANK函数的核心功能就是判断一个值是否为空,它的返回结果是TRUE或FALSE,对应于空值和非空值。值得注意的是,IS函数的参数"value"是不能转换的,任何使用双引号括起来的数值会...

excel的if函数,如果判断对象不是空值则返回某数值,如果对象为空值怎么...
首先,打开您的Excel表格并选择A1单元格。接着,在B1单元格内输入公式:=if(A1>"",5,"")。 这条公式中的"=""表示空值,当A1单元格内容不为空时,即非空,函数返回数值5。若A1单元格为空,则返回空值。点击回车,此时B1单元格显示为空。然后,在A1单元格输入任意文本或数字(如“1”),按下...

excel的if函数,如果判断对象不是空值则返回某数值,如果对象为空值怎么...
在使用IF函数处理空值时,需要将其作为判断条件。例如,使用IF(NOT(ISBLANK(A1)), "存在值", "空值"),来判断单元格A1是否为空。在多条件判断场景下,可以使用IFS函数简化嵌套逻辑,提高代码可读性。例如,使用=IFS(条件1, 结果1, 条件2, 结果2, ...),根据不同的条件返回不同的结果。处理错...

相似回答
大家正在搜